Rustic Farmhouse Charm
1. Burlap “Give Thanks” Banner
A classic burlap banner with stenciled white letters spelling out “Give Thanks” gives your space that warm, rustic farmhouse touch.
2. Wooden Pumpkin Cutout Sign
Hand-painted wooden pumpkins lined up on a mantle or wall bring fall harvest charm into your home.
3. Chalkboard Menu Board
A vintage-style chalkboard with your Thanksgiving dinner menu creates a welcoming touch for guests.

4. Pallet Wood “Harvest” Sign
Old pallet wood transformed into a hand-painted harvest sign fits beautifully in farmhouse-inspired spaces.
5. Burlap & Lace Banner
Add lace trim to a burlap banner for a rustic-yet-elegant Thanksgiving accent.
6. Mason Jar String Lights Banner
Mini mason jars filled with string lights hung like a banner brighten any entryway.
7. Hand-Painted Barnwood Sign
Barnwood painted with festive fall quotes adds a touch of rustic history.
8. Jute Rope “Thankful” Banner
Thick rope cut into pennants with painted letters spelling “Thankful” makes a bold farmhouse statement.
9. Wooden Arrow Sign
Point your guests toward the dining room with a hand-painted Thanksgiving arrow sign.
10. Galvanized Metal Harvest Letters
Large galvanized metal letters spelling “Harvest” bring an industrial farmhouse look.

11. Wheat Bundle Hanging Banner
Small bundles of dried wheat tied to twine make a natural banner.
12. Pumpkin Patch Wood Sign
A distressed wood sign reading “Pumpkin Patch” adds fall whimsy to porches.
13. Rustic Barn Door Banner
Hang a mini banner across a sliding barn door for a charming seasonal update.
14. Plaid Fabric Banner
Cut plaid fabric triangles for a warm and cozy banner design.
15. “Bless This Home” Rustic Sign
Painted wood with distressed edges featuring a heartfelt Thanksgiving quote.
16. Grapevine Garland Banner
Weave paper or wood letters into a grapevine garland for a natural look.
17. Burlap Sack Pennant Banner
Repurpose old grain sacks into a unique pennant-style banner.
18. Mini Wooden Crate Sign
Stacked mini crates with painted Thanksgiving words make a rustic sign alternative.
19. Painted Corn Husk Banner
Corn husks painted in fall tones strung together for a harvest banner.
20. Wooden Ladder Sign
Decorate an old wooden ladder with Thanksgiving quotes painted across the rungs.
21. Shiplap “Thankful & Blessed” Sign
White shiplap boards with dark hand lettering are a farmhouse staple.
22. Twine & Paper Leaf Banner
Cut fall-colored paper leaves and attach them to twine for a simple, rustic banner.
23. Pumpkin Carving Stencil Sign
Paint stenciled pumpkin carvings onto reclaimed wood for a playful rustic touch.
24. Quilted Fabric Banner
Use patchwork quilt pieces to create a cozy Thanksgiving garland.
25. Distressed Wooden “Family” Sign
A painted wood sign with the word “Family” makes a timeless farmhouse piece.
